在数学中,海伦公式是一种用于计算三角形面积的重要工具。它是以古希腊数学家海伦娜(Helen of Troy)的名字命名的,她据说是世界上最美丽的女人之一。海伦公式的推导和应用在几何学和三角学中都具有重要意义。
什么是海伦公式?
海伦公式提供了一种计算任意三角形面积的方法,无论其形状是否规则。它基于三角形的三条边长,并能够得出一个精确的结果。这个公式的形式如下:
S = √(s(s-a)(s-b)(s-c))
其中,S表示三角形的面积,a、b、c分别表示三角形的三条边长,s表示半周长(即三角形的周长除以2)。需要注意的是,根号符号代表对括号内部进行开平方运算。
通过使用海伦公式,我们可以快速而准确地计算任意三角形的面积,而不仅限于等边三角形或直角三角形。
如何在Python中实现海伦公式?
Python是一种功能强大且易于使用的编程语言,非常适合用于数学计算。要在Python中实现海伦公式,我们可以编写一个函数,接受三个参数(三角形的三条边长),并返回计算得到的面积。
以下是一个用Python实现海伦公式的函数的示例代码:
def triangle_area(a, b, c):
s = (a + b + c) / 2
area = (s * (s - a) * (s - b) * (s - c)) ** 0.5
return area
在这个函数中,我们首先计算出半周长s,然后使用海伦公式计算出三角形的面积area,最后将其返回。
如何使用这个函数?
要使用这个函数,我们只需要传入三角形的三条边长作为参数,并调用函数即可。下面是一个示例:
a = 3
b = 4
c = 5
area = triangle_area(a, b, c)
print("三角形的面积为:", area)
在这个示例中,我们假设三角形的三条边长分别为3、4和5。然后,我们调用triangle_area
函数,传入这三个参数,并将返回的面积存储在area
变量中。最后,我们使用print
函数输出计算得到的面积。
总结
海伦公式是一种用于计算三角形面积的重要工具。通过编写一个简单的Python函数,我们可以快速而准确地计算任意三角形的面积。希望本文对你理解海伦公式及其在Python中的应用有所帮助。
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试